Perak health exco taken to task
2021-08-27 00:00:00.0     星报-国家     原网页

       

       IPOH: The Perak state health committee chairman has come under fire for not going to the ground during the Covid-19 pandemic.

       Several opposition assemblymen raised the issue during their debate on the motion of thanks to the Royal Address at the state assembly yesterday.

       Many in the opposition acknowledged that Mentri Besar Datuk Saarani Mohamad was instead doing the job of Mohd Akmal Kamaruddin.Tan Kar Hing (Simpang Pulai-PKR), Howard Lee (Pasir Pinji- DAP), and Datuk Asmuni Awi (Manjoi-Amanah) were among the few who took a dig at Mohd Akmal.

       Tan said with the number of Covid-19 cases on the rise in Perak, the only person seen doing the job of the health exco was Saarani.

       “We have seen the Mentri Besar at the openings of vaccination centres and visiting enhanced movement control order areas, outreach vaccine programmes and other related events, but not the health committee chairman.

       “I am wondering if the health exco is busier than the Mentri Besar because we don’t see him doing his job on the ground,” he said.

       Tan said that like him, other assemblymen were surely bombarded with questions from constituents on the slow pace of the vaccination process, measures taken to handle the pandemic, or when more economic sectors are able to operate and so forth.

       “As the Malay proverb goes, ‘Harapkan pagar, pagar makan padi’ (we depend on the fence, yet the fence eats the padi).

       “Here, I would like to add another line: ‘Harapkan exco, exco mana pergi’ (we depend on the exco, but where did he go)?” he added.

       Tan said about 500,000 people had yet to be vaccinated in Perak and that compared to other states, Perak was third from the bottom after Sabah and Kelantan in terms of the vaccination process.

       “I suggest setting up a special health select committee. If the health exco cannot do his job, there should be a reshuffle to get someone who can do a better job,” he added.Lee said he was not criticising the exco just for the sake of criticism, but because he was nowhere to be seen during such a critical time.

       “People are suffering not only due to the virus, but also the economy. But what we see is the Mentri Besar doing the job of the health exco,” he added.

       He said many issues needed to be tackled on the ground, but the exco was not playing his part.

       He said there were cases of senior citizens who could not make it to their vaccination appointments as they were given short notice and depended on their children for transportation.

       “There are also cases of people getting appointments far away from their homes. Not everyone is able to travel that far,” Asmuni said.

       During a reply to a written question earlier, Saarani said Perak was expected to attain herd immunity by October.

       He said to enhance the Covid-19 National Vaccination Programme, the state government was assessing a proposal to set up 12 more new vaccination centres and upgrade the existing three centres.

       He said depending on the supply of vaccines, the state’s vaccination process was expected to be completed by November.
